Obituary of James H. Thomas
James H. Thomas II of Melbourne, Florida passed away peacefully in his sleep on Tuesday, October 31, 2023, at home. He was born to the son of a sharecropper, John Davis Thomas and his loving wife Elenor, a schoolteacher, in Drew, Mississippi on July 25, 1938. His twin brother, John, predeceased him, as well as sisters Mary, Martha, and Ruth. He is survived by his brother Charles and sister Evelyn.
Jim, as he was affectionately known by all, is survived by his wife of 63 years, Arleen as well as 7 of 9 children, 17 grandchildren and 18 great-grandchildren. He joins his two boys, Todd and Derek in Heaven who predeceased him. His surviving children, Jim (Katherine) Thomas, Kimberly (Stacy) Rutland, Angelina (Christopher) Salvagio, Valerie Dube', John (Jolyn) Thomas, Michelle (Humberto) Pedroso, and Chad (Martha) Thomas.
He proudly served his country in the United States Air Force for 23 years before retiring as a noncommissioned Officer. His service continued with his country in the United States Customs Service for an additional 16 years before permanently retiring and settling in Melbourne, Florida. Jim lived to serve his country, family, and faith. He was a member of St John the Evangelist Catholic Church in Viera. Jim was loved by all who knew him and will be missed dearly.
